Coronation Street fans spot moment Becky Swain makes ‘plan’ amid ‘murder’ prediction
Becky’s return has got in between Lisa Swain and Carla Connor’s relationship in the ITV soap
Coronation Street fans think they have spotted the moment that Becky Swain knew she needed to get rid of Carla Connor after she admitted her plans to get her family back – whatever it takes.
Those who follow the ITV soap are keen to see the back of the former cop, and Lisa Swain’s ex-wife, following her unexpected return from the dead back in September, much to the shock of Lisa.
The timing couldn’t have been more unfortunate, with Becky’s arrival coming just after Lisa and her new partner, Carla, had moved into their first home, No.6 Coronation Street, together, before, after a number of failed proposals, Lisa popped the question to Carla.
Days after their engagement, Becky made a sudden appearance, claiming she had been put in witness protection after an undercover operation went wrong. She returned Betsy’s 18th birthday, with it also revealed that DI Costello was in on faking Becky’s death.
Becky has since been getting in between Lisa and Carla, with a clear intention to get her family back together – whatever it takes – and she’s already succeeded in splitting them up, as Carla, feeling pushed aside by her partner, called time on her and Lisa’s relationship.
But Carla is now working with Lisa’s colleague, DC Kit Green, to try and get to the bottom of what Becky and Costello have been hiding for all this time. However, Costello now being in hospital having been subject to a brutal attack is making things more difficult.
During Wednesday’s (December 10) episode of Corrie, Kit headed to No.6 and revealed that Costello was set to retire in September before Becky’s return. He went on to speak to Carla, telling her they need to stick their plan to expose the bent coppers.
After leaving the factory, Kit bumped into Becky and told her that Carla was drinking herself silly, and that she should tell Lisa to go visit her. However, Becky paid her a visit instead and smugly revealed that she intended to win Lisa back, whatever it took, and that she’d got her way.
But when Carla returned to No.6, Becky was quick to protest Carla was drunk, but she confirmed she was completely sober and that she’d just pretended in order to record Becky’s confession. However, it appeared Lisa didn’t really want to listen, feeling like a pawn in Becky and Carla’s game.
With Lisa having walked out, quickly followed by Betsy, Carla was left alone Becky and told her she wouldn’t give up. “You think you’re so clever, don’t you?” she scowled. “But I’ve got to warn you, I’m a stubborn cow, I’m gonna find out what you are and just what you’ve been up to,” Carla added.
Setting her plan into motion, Carla made a visit of her own to Costello, where he woke up and confirmed Becky was behind his attack, and gave her the words ‘Rhubarb Hill’, seemingly a clue to what she and Kit are trying to expose.
But it was Carla’s warning to Becky which sparked concern, as its left them fearing for the Weatherfield stalwart, who has already been revealed to mysteriously disappear at Christmas, with the current running theory being that she’s kidnapped.
